Overview of the Spanish River Carbonatite (SRC) deposit located near the Spanish River in Ontario, Canada. Five zones were considered for the study and are delineated by the black lines: the quarry (grey circle) where SRC is actively mined (Q), the inner core (IC), the outer core (OC), the transition zone (TZ), and the outside of the deposit (OU).

MINING CLAIMS Se LEASES The Spanish River Carbonatite Complex property consisted of 14 mining claims and 6 leased located in Tofflemire and Venturi townships, district of Sudbury. The mining claims are 10007o owned by Agricultural Mineral Prospectors Inc. and held in trust by Chris Caron (C38620) and John Slack.

Spanish River Carbonatite Use: Soil Amendment PANISH RIVER CARBONATITE (SRC) is a natural blend of minerals mined from a volcanic deposit in Northern Ontario. It is made up of 65% calcite, which buffers acid soils, and is a source of calcium and trace ...

The phosphorus found in carbonatite can be found in its apatite content. Unfortunately, many phosphate containing rocks tend to also have significant levels of heavy metals and radioactive isotopes, including cadmium, thorium and uranium. The apatite found in Spanish River Carbonatite is free of these types of heavy minerals and radioactivity.
